Output 8ec60b03b6db5f3a94f3de93da55dd1536f04435cd0c9f1cbccc932547d3133e:1

value
34295
script pubkey
OP_0 OP_PUSHBYTES_20 383033a52ebd7ddaaa6de3a82e250bce84afea8f
address
bc1q8qcr8ffwh47a42nduw5zufgte6z2l65083dtjq
transaction
8ec60b03b6db5f3a94f3de93da55dd1536f04435cd0c9f1cbccc932547d3133e
spent
true